Web3.1 Methodological Issues in Bioenergy Life-Cycle GHG Emissions 14 3.1.1 System boundaries, wastes, and by-product allocation 14 3.1.2 Direct Land-Use Change 15 WebNov 7, 2024 · Biomass and biofuels made from biomass are alternative energy sources to fossil fuels—coal, petroleum, and natural gas. Burning either fossil fuels or biomass releases carbon dioxide (CO 2 ), a greenhouse gas. However, the plants that are the source of biomass for energy capture almost the same amount of CO 2 through photosynthesis …
